
Shoot with GoPro like a Pro: Tips and Tricks from Donald Miralle
Marathon runners push through the high heat and humidity during the 2013 Ironman World Championship in Kailua-Kona, Hawaii. @donaldmiralle
Still wondering how to capture professional grade photographs with a GoPro camera? To give you some of the best advice we interviewed Donald Miralle, recipient of over 40 international awards, one of the most innovative sport photographers in the industry, and overall an incredible person. The December/January Issue of LAVA magazine featured a 9-page photo gallery, and included a variety of Miralle's photography from the Ironman World Championships from Kona. He is a GoPro expert and was willing to break down some secrets of how to best utilize the camera as a tool to take print-worthy photos, especially within endurance sports.
What are the benefits of having GoPro in your tool/camera kit?
For all my shoots, whether it be commercial or editorial content, I bring GoPros in my camera bag with me. Over the years, I've found that having a GoPro with me was always a good supplement for productions. I would usually set up a GoPro on a tripod when we started a shoot, and just let it run forgetting it was there, and be surprised what it would capture later on. Sometimes clients wanted these behind the scenes shots and I have actually seen the footage I have captured out of them as one of the main images as part of a campaign. Ive started to think about specific angles specifically for the GoPro where I couldnt place 35mm gear, or also have them shooting attached to my 35mm gear as backup. There have been times when my 35mm camera missed a moment but the GoPro did not! Its really amazing what these little cameras are capable of now!

How did you capture the GoPro shots that were printed in LAVA?
The GoPro images that were specifically used in LAVA magazine from the Kona Ironman World Championships have been captured in various ways over the years. In 2014, a camera that I placed on top of the finish line/start tower caught not only the moment the swimmers jumped into the water at the start, but then was repositioned to also capture the exact moment that Sebastien Kienle broke the tape crossed the finish line as the new world champion. Both of these were set on a multi-shot mode where I captured an image every half second; therefore, I was able to use as a time lapse video of both the start and the finish in addition to pulling out single frames for print. Last year, I connected it to my underwater 35mm housing, and it ended up getting an amazing image from the mass start from 30 feet below the swimmers, which was better than the image my 35mm captured. I also mounted a camera underneath the entry stairs for the water, which created a very abstract and original angle of the swimmers exiting the water. I couple years back when I wasnt in the NBC helicopter, I flew a small drone at a couple safe locations during the swim, bike and run, and was rewarded with some very interesting angles. Outside of the images printed in LAVA, I have used the GoPro's for video footage during the race, which has been a supplement to my coverage of the Ironman.

What are your favorite modes and techniques to get a GoPro shot?
If I am setting up a GoPro somewhere getting a static shot, I usually use the timelapse mode, varying the shots from every .5 second to 5 seconds depending on the duration of the activity I am shooting. For example, for the swim start since it spans a fairly short time from pre-sunrise at 6:30ish to 7:30 when the last swimmer enters the water, I have it on very short half-second intervals. Something spanning for several hours like setup and break down of the finish line I will make sure I have a power supply to plug the GoPro into and run longer intervals like every 5 seconds or so. Ive found the using the video + photo mode very helpful when I need mostly video from a scene but also need a couple decent jpeg general views as well. I often use a pole cam to get a slightly elevated view of a scene and to clean up a background, and every now and then for the selfie too! And if I really want a more extreme elevated angle and safety and time permits, Im also a big proponent of aerial and drone photography. I usually fly a DJI Phantom I or II, with a Zenmuse Gimbal, and a live-view screen attached to the remote control so I can keep a line of site with the quadcopter. With the heightened safety precautions and FAA rules with aerial/drone photography, I never fly unless I have full satellite coverage and homing GPS enabled. Also, I won't fly in bad weather conditions, highly populated areas or near airports. I will always make sure to only shoot under canopies at low elevations. When used safely and correctly, you can capture some amazing aerial views from a GoPro and Quadcopter that wouldnt be possible otherwise.

If you had only one go-to setting in the water, what mode would you use?
In the water, whether I am using it attached to my larger camera or a GoPro mount, I have it on the burst mode (30 frames per second). More times than not I have noticed that most things happen in the water very quickly and pass by you very quickly. Ive had the most success in burst mode whether its shooting a wave barreling over a reef or 2000 triathletes splashing on the surface of the water.
